python如何导入png

python如何导入png

作者:Elara发布时间:2026-01-05阅读时长:0 分钟阅读次数:15

用户关注问题

Q
Python中有哪些方法可以导入PNG图片?

我想在Python程序中使用PNG格式的图片,应该采用哪些库或方法来导入这些图片?

A

使用Pillow库导入PNG图片的方法

在Python中,Pillow库是处理图像最常用的库之一。可以通过from PIL import Image导入,然后使用Image.open('path_to_image.png')方法读取PNG文件。这种方法简单高效,适用于大多数图像处理需求。

Q
如何在Python中加载PNG图片以便进行图像处理?

我计划对PNG格式的图片进行编辑和处理,有哪些步骤可以加载PNG图片并确保图像数据可用?

A

使用OpenCV库加载PNG图片的步骤

OpenCV是一个强大的计算机视觉库,可以通过import cv2导入,然后利用cv2.imread('path_to_image.png', cv2.IMREAD_UNCHANGED)读取PNG图片。这样可以获得包含透明通道的完整图像数据,方便后续处理。

Q
怎样确保Python程序正确识别PNG格式的图片文件?

在使用Python导入PNG图片时,有时会遇到格式识别错误,怎样避免这类问题?

A

验证和加载PNG图片的注意事项

确认文件路径和文件名的正确性至关重要,同时使用支持PNG格式的库,如Pillow或OpenCV,都能有效避免格式识别问题。另外,可通过异常处理机制捕捉错误,及时反馈文件是否有效,保障程序稳定运行。